    Getting There

    Walking

    From the Blackstone District, start at the intersection of Farnam Street and 40th Street. Head east on Farnam Street for about 1 mile. Continue straight until you reach 11th Street. The Arch is located at 1110 Farnam St, Omaha, NE 68102, right at the corner with 11th Street.

    Biking

    If you prefer biking, you can rent a bike from one of the local bike-sharing stations in the Blackstone District. Head east on Farnam Street, following the same route as for walking. The bike ride is approximately 1 mile and should take you around 5-10 minutes, depending on your pace. Remember to park your bike at a designated bike rack when you arrive at The Arch.

    Public Transit

    For public transit, you can catch the Omaha Metro bus at the nearest stop on Farnam Street. Look for bus route 2, which travels towards downtown Omaha. Board the bus and ride until you reach the stop at 11th and Farnam. The Arch will be a short walk from there, just across the street. A single ride on the bus costs $1.25.
